So i am trying to create a directory with a Home,Blog,and Contact selection. But every time i click on one of them they all go back to the home page. How do i fix this, and here is the secton of code below. let me know if you need to see more

<div class="well bs-sidebar" id="sidebar" style="background-color:#fff">
       <ol class="nav nav-pills nav-stacked">
        <li><a href='/'>Home</a></li>
        <li><a href='/blog/'>Blog</a></li>
        <li><a href='/contact/'>Contact</a></li>
       </ol>
      </div>
